Figure 2-26 shows a grade report that is mailed to students at the end of each semester. Prepare an ERD reflecting the data contained in the grade report. Assume that each course is taught by one instructor. Also, draw this data model using the tool you have been told to use in the course. Explain what you chose for the identifier of each entity type on your ERD.
Figure 2-26 Grade report
Trending nowThis is a popular solution!
Learn your wayIncludes step-by-step video
Chapter 2 Solutions
Modern Database Management
Additional Engineering Textbook Solutions
Starting Out With Visual Basic (7th Edition)
Starting Out with Programming Logic and Design (4th Edition)
Starting Out with Python (4th Edition)
Starting Out with C++: Early Objects
Starting Out with C++ from Control Structures to Objects (9th Edition)
Java: An Introduction to Problem Solving and Programming (7th Edition)
- What kinds of data would you store in an entity subtype?arrow_forwardDevelop a simple data model for a student database that includes student data, student contact data, student demographic data, student grades data, and student financial data. Determine the data attributes that should be present in each table, and identify the primary key for each table. Develop a complete entity relationship diagram that shows how these tables are related to one another.arrow_forwardDesign an entity–relationship diagram for this database. Identify primary keys and relationship cardinalities using(min:max)notation. If you make any assumptions, please state them clearly.arrow_forward
- Make an Entity relationship diagram and use the Erdplus and apply these requirments Using the Erdplus(use it to make this diagram, the answer should be as a Diagram) Q) Create an entity-relationship diagram (ERD) using min-max notation based on the following datarequirements of the University database:1. The university is organized into colleges, and each college has a unique number, unique name, and a particularfaculty member who is the dean of the college. Each college administers a number of academic departments.2. Each department has a unique name, a unique code number, and a particular faculty member who chairs thedepartment. We need to keep track of the start date when that faculty member began chairing the department.In addition, each department may have several faculties and must be administered by one college.3. A department offers several courses, each of which has a unique course name, a unique code number, a courselevel (Level: this can be coded as 1 for freshman level, 2…arrow_forwardGiven these business rules, create the Entity Relationship Diagram, include relationships and cardinalities. A bookstore is modeling its data. On one part, we have the READERS. Readers have a registration ID, name composed by first name and last name, mailing address and list of topics of interest (cooking, fiction, etc). The books available for readers will be stored with title, year of publication, isbn code and a list of topics that the book is tagged for. Authors are also to be stored with an authorID, name composed by first name, middle name and last name, mailing address and date of birth. One book can have multiple authors, but must have at least one. One author can write multiple books, one book or even be registered as an author without authoring any books. A customer can own multiple books and only starts being a costumer after buying her/his first book. I need help understanding how this works and how I put it togetherarrow_forward1. Create an entity relationship diagram for the conceptual design using UML notation. The diagram can be created by hand or via some modeling tool. 2. Create a data dictionary for the entities, relationships and attributes. Make your best guess for representing the attributes. Schema 3 You have been hired by the Snowbird ski mountain resort to build a database for their data. The resort has ski mountain peaks, chair lifts, trails, stores and restaurants. For each mountain peak, you track the name, the elevation and its latitude and longitude. Each peak name is unique. The names of the mountain peaks are: Mount Superior, Mount Baldy, Twin Peaks and Hidden Peak. For each chair lift, you track a unique name, the vertical rise, the travel time, the number of people per chair (ranging from 2 to 4) , and its closing time. For each trail, you track its unique name, its elevation, its length, and the typical time it takes to complete. Each ski trail is classified by its level of…arrow_forward
- What do business rules NOT help define within a data model? a.) Attributes b.) Relationships c.) Entitites d.) Valuesarrow_forward8. List all of the attributes of a movie. 9. According to the data model, is it required that every entity instance in the PRODUCT table be associated with an entity instance in the CD table? Why, or why not? 10. Is it possible for a book to appear in the BOOK table without appearing in the PRODUCT table? Why, or why not?arrow_forwardCreate a logical data model documented with an ERD using the crow’s foot format. Be sure that each entity has the entity name at the top of the box, the primary key attribute or attributes in the middle of the box, and the non-key attributes in the bottom of the box. Lines should separate each part of the entity box. Follow these instructions about each ERD: ● The ERD must not have any many-to-many (m:n) relationships. ● All attributes must be placed within an entity. ● Each entity must have a primary key defined. A primary key can consist of one or more attributes. ● Each relationship must have a foreign key. Denote the foreign key(s) with the notation (FK) on the ERD. Remember that in a one-to-many relationship, the foreign key is placed in the entity that is on the many side of the relationship. ● Each relationship must include both a maximum and minimum cardinality for both sides of the relationship. ● Each relationship should have a verb or verb phrase to describe it. Question:…arrow_forward
- Part 2: Relational data model. Take a subset of the ideas from the conceptual model you constructed in Part 1 and design a simple relationship model similar to the ones we discussed in Module 2, Video 4 Your model should have at least 5 tables You should include at least 20 attributes, or fields, in your model (20 total across all tables, not per table) Your model should be normalized Identify the primary key in each table, and state whether it is a natural or surrogate key For each relationship between tables, identify any foreign keys needed to define the relationship For each table, identify what type of system or systems you think the data might come from, like those we discussed in Module 1, Video 6.arrow_forwardIllustrate an Entity-Relationship Diagram (ERD) model using Crow’s Foot notation Here we can have the following entities 1.patients:this entity will store the details of the patients and the attributes for this entity is id(which is unique for each patient and can be used as a primary key) name(this attribute will store the name of the patient and it is a composite attribute) address(this attribute will store the address of the patient and it is multi valued attribute. ) contact_num(this is also a multi valued attribute which will store the contact details of the patient). age(which is a derived attribute) 2.room:this entity will store the information about the details of the rooms. The attributes are. id(this is unique for each room and can be used as a primary key) room number(this will store the room number) Total_bed(this will store the total number of beds present in that room) 3. Bed:this entity will store the information regarding to each bed present in an room, and the…arrow_forward
- Database Systems: Design, Implementation, & Manag...Computer ScienceISBN:9781305627482Author:Carlos Coronel, Steven MorrisPublisher:Cengage LearningDatabase Systems: Design, Implementation, & Manag...Computer ScienceISBN:9781285196145Author:Steven, Steven Morris, Carlos Coronel, Carlos, Coronel, Carlos; Morris, Carlos Coronel and Steven Morris, Carlos Coronel; Steven Morris, Steven Morris; Carlos CoronelPublisher:Cengage LearningPrinciples of Information Systems (MindTap Course...Computer ScienceISBN:9781285867168Author:Ralph Stair, George ReynoldsPublisher:Cengage Learning
- Fundamentals of Information SystemsComputer ScienceISBN:9781305082168Author:Ralph Stair, George ReynoldsPublisher:Cengage Learning